FC Barcelona ended Matchday 1 of the 2025–26 La Liga season as league leaders on goal difference after Saturday’s 3–0 win at Son Moix. The opening round wrapped up on Tuesday, August 19, when Real Madrid beat Osasuna 1–0 on a Kylian Mbappé penalty.
